What It Means

This phrase, ter jeito, is super common in Portuguese. It's not about having a physical path or road. Instead, it means to possess the skill, knack, or solution to handle a situation. It implies competence or the existence of a fix. You might use it when you figure out a tricky problem or when you see someone else handle a tough task with ease. It’s like saying, 'Ah, there’s a way to do this!' or 'He’s got the knack for it.' It often carries a positive, problem-solving vibe, but can also be used sarcastically. Think of it as the Portuguese equivalent of 'having it figured out.' It's a little bit magic, a little bit practical.

How To Use It

You use ter jeito when you want to talk about having a solution or a skill. If a problem seems impossible, but you find a way, you tem jeito. If someone is really good at something, they tem jeito for it. It can describe a person, an object, or even a situation. For example, if your old computer is slow but you know how to speed it up, you could say, 'Meu computador antigo está lento, mas eu tenho jeito para ele.' (My old computer is slow, but I have a way with it.) It's flexible! You can use it for yourself, others, or even inanimate objects. Just remember, it’s about the *ability* to solve or manage.

Real-Life Examples

Imagine your friend is struggling to assemble IKEA furniture. You step in and, after a bit of fiddling, get it done. You might say, 'Eu tenho jeito com essas coisas!' (I have a knack for these things!). Or maybe your car breaks down, and a mechanic says, 'Não se preocupe, a gente tem jeito pra isso.' (Don't worry, we have a solution for this.) It’s also used when things seem broken but aren't. 'Essa blusa parece rasgada, mas tem jeito com uma costura.' (This blouse looks torn, but it can be fixed with a stitch.) It's everywhere!

When To Use It

Use ter jeito when you want to express confidence in solving a problem. It’s great for situations where a solution isn't obvious but exists. Use it when praising someone's skills or talent. 'Ela tem jeito para cozinhar' (She has a knack for cooking). It’s perfect for describing how to fix something, even if it requires a bit of creativity. Think of it as a compliment to ingenuity. You can also use it when you're feeling optimistic about a difficult task. It’s a phrase that brings a sense of capability and hope. When NOT To Use It

Avoid ter jeito when there genuinely is no solution or fix. Saying 'Isso tem jeito' (This has a solution) about a truly unfixable problem sounds clueless or even sarcastic in the wrong tone. Don't use it for abstract concepts that aren't about problem-solving, like 'Amor tem jeito?' (Does love have a solution?) unless you're being very metaphorical. Also, it's generally not for highly technical or scientific solutions unless you're simplifying. Stick to contexts where skill, a trick, or a practical fix is involved. It's not for explaining complex theories, unless you're adding a touch of folksy wisdom. And definitely don't use it in a super formal, academic setting unless you want to sound a bit too casual.

Common Mistakes

A big one is confusing it with haver jeito (which is less common but means 'there is a way'). People often try to translate it too literally. Another mistake is using it for things that are inherently impossible or unchangeable. For instance, saying 'O tempo tem jeito' (The weather has a solution) won't work unless you mean you have a way to *deal* with the weather, like bringing an umbrella. Also, mixing up the verb conjugation is common. Remember, it's ter (to have), so you conjugate ter, not haver.

Essa situação não *há jeito* Essa situação não *tem jeito*
Eu não *tenho jeito* para matemática Eu *tenho jeito* para matemática (if you are good at it)

Similar Expressions

Dar um jeito is a close cousin. It means 'to find a way' or 'to sort something out,' often implying resourcefulness or improvisation. While ter jeito suggests a pre-existing skill or solution, dar um jeito is about actively creating one. Ter solução is more direct and less idiomatic; it simply means 'to have a solution.' Ser bom em algo means 'to be good at something,' focusing purely on skill without the implication of a specific fix or knack. Ter manha is similar to ter jeito for specific tasks, meaning to have a trick or a secret technique.

Common Variations

Sometimes you'll hear tem jeito used almost as a standalone phrase, like a question: 'E aí, tem jeito?' (So, is there a way?). Or as an answer: 'Pra isso? Tem jeito!' (For this? There's a way!). You might also hear ter jeito para as coisas, which is a broader way of saying someone is generally capable or has a knack for handling matters. In some regions, you might hear slight variations, but the core meaning remains. It's a very adaptable phrase, like a Swiss Army knife of Portuguese expressions.

Quick FAQ

Q. Is ter jeito always positive?

A. Not always! It can be used sarcastically to mean something is hopeless, like 'Ah, pra isso não tem jeito mesmo.' (Ah, for this there really is no way.) It depends heavily on tone and context, just like sarcasm in English.

Q. Can I use it for skills like playing guitar?

A. Absolutely! If you play guitar well, you tem jeito for music. It covers both practical fixes and talents. It's a versatile phrase for capability.

Q. What if I don't know the solution?

A. Then you don't tem jeito for that specific problem *yet*. You might need to dar um jeito (find a way) first. It implies you either already have the knack or you're about to figure it out with skill.

ملاحظات الاستخدام

This phrase is overwhelmingly informal and colloquial, primarily used in spoken Brazilian Portuguese. While it can sometimes appear in casual writing (like social media), avoid it in formal documents, academic papers, or highly professional settings. The core idea is possessing a 'way' or 'knack' to fix, manage, or accomplish something, often implying resourcefulness or a specific talent.
